ABOUT THE ARTIST

Since childhood, Beat Matti loved to paint and draw. Art has always been an integral part of the Matti family. Beat’s mother Ruth, also an artist, played an important role by encouraging her son to pursue his artistic talent. Following his architectural studies in Thun, Beat decided to be self-employed as an architectural draftsman, allowing him the flexibility to paint. For the past 18 years, Beat has painted professionally, starting with the first painting he sold in 1989. Since then, Beat has created over 1,000 works in different techniques (oil, acrylic, watercolor, ink, etc.) He is inspired by realism, impressionism and the abstract.

Having grown up in the mountains, he is drawn to the ever-changing sky and slope colors. In addition, while spending time in southern India, he was inspired by the vivid colors, varying shades of brown as well as the color and spirit of the Indian people. During his world travels and time away from the studio, he photographs, sketches and captures landscape details and texture.

Back in his Saanen schoolhouse studio, he integrates the themes of rural and mountain scenes to create his well-recognized landscapes. The artist employs acrylic and oil on his canvases. Currently, Beat spends a lot of time at his alpine hut in Gruben, above the bustling Gstaad and Saanen valleys. This gives him the peace and time he needs to explore and paint his favorite mountains with their gurgling streams and bustling forests. Be it winter, summer, spring or fall, nature continues to provide Beat with endless ideas and inspiration.

BIOGRAPHY

1965 Born in Saanen, Switzerland
1972 - 1981 Attendance of Saanen Primary and Secondary schools
1985 Studies and degree as architectural draughtsman, Thun
1989 Co-founded architectural and design firm Matti & Rime, Saanen
1989 - 1992 Atelier in Rougemont. Autodidactic experiment with watercolor, acrylic, and oil. Recycling objects. Sold first work.
1992 - 1993 Trip around the world, including Australia, New Zealand, Hawaii, east Asia. Batik classes and painting in Yogyakarta, Indonesia.
1994 Started to work in studio at the old Saanen schoolhouse.
1997 - 1998 Worked with Indian painter Ashokan Nanniyode in Trivendrum, Kerala, southern India.
